Default Purple cauliflower

This purple cauliflower, Violet Queen, is one confused brassica. The plants look like cauliflower plants with light green, narrow, pointed leaves, but the curd is purple and looks just like a broccoli floret. I haven't eaten it yet, so I don't know whether it tastes like cauliflower or broccoli. The purple goes away upon heating and to give a green floret.
